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34198185 11235271 27656659811 09
2078 93 756508724
2078 93 756508724
34638 31050017 00683329
All about undefined
Interested in learning more?
2078 93 756508724
34638 31050017 00683329
See more
9583 72496550
012 1799 2954923090
See more
3675181012 72
1309 90966331 674585 59443524870
See more